The Pocket Medical Encyclopedia for Windows Mobile® smartphones is brought to you in joined effort between MedicineNet and Beiks, two leading companies in the fields of medical reference content and mobile reference applications respectively.

It consists of two parts, the MedicineNet''s Medical Encyclopedia and BDicty (pronounced "bi-dikti") - the general dictionary reader application, developed by Beiks. Here is some information for each of them:

MedicineNet''s Medical Encyclopedia

Written entirely by U.S. board certified physicians, this reference work includes more than 10,500 entries from the medical field. These include not only the usual standard medical terms but also pertinent scientific items, abbreviations, acronyms, jargon, institutions, projects, symptoms, syndromes, eponyms, medical history and particularly anything of value and of interest.

MedicineNet''s award winning content has been recognized in publications such as Yahoo! Internet Life, and U.S. News and World Report. The MedicineNet doctors are proud to have authored the Webster''s New World Medical Dictionary published in June 2000 by John Wiley & Sons, Inc. MedicineNet''s content is used by libraries, government agencies, doctor''s offices, pharmacy networks, hospitals, insurance organizations, medical schools, and other healthcare organizations worldwide.
